Нолики в больших фокспрошных базах

Обсуждение технических вопросов по продуктам Novell

Нолики в больших фокспрошных базах

Сообщение rusakov_sa » 25 авг 2003, 09:41

Привет всем!
Есть проблема. Используется FoxPro 2.6. Иногда на больших файлах (20 мег и больше) получается такая штука: если смотреть фаром, то конец файла забит нулями, хотя данные там есть...
Лечится копированием файла на станцию и потом обратно с последующей переиндексацией. Иногда часть данных все-таки теряется.
Данный глюк Новелу известен, причем давно (TurboFAT error). У нас эти проблемы были на 4.11, надеялись, что с переходом на 5.1 проблемы исчезнут. Они действительно пропали на пол-года, потом опять выплыло (NW51SP6).
В качестве лечения Новел предлагает модуль для отключения турбо-фата. На 4.11 эта штука у меня так и не сработала, т.е. нолики появлялись, а производительность упала. Что, на 5.1 тоже надо turbo FAT disable вструмлять?
Может быть у народа есть какой-нибудь другой workaround?

Сергей Русаков
rusakov_sa
 
Сообщения: 24
Зарегистрирован: 24 июн 2003, 09:59
Откуда: Кемерово

a

Сообщение Юрий aka qwerty » 26 авг 2003, 03:20

у меня на NW6 tdis600.nlm работает и на 4-ке работал(turbodis вроде)....
Аватара пользователя
Юрий aka qwerty
 
Сообщения: 152
Зарегистрирован: 12 июн 2002, 06:32
Откуда: г.Иркутск

Сообщение rusakov_sa » 26 авг 2003, 04:01

И как производительность? Не упала?
У меня программеры на следующий же день возопили, что сервер тормозить стал...

Сергей Русаков
rusakov_sa
 
Сообщения: 24
Зарегистрирован: 24 июн 2003, 09:59
Откуда: Кемерово

ф

Сообщение Юрий aka qwerty » 26 авг 2003, 11:40

Очень сомневаюсь, что из-за этого так ощутимо упала производительность ....
Да даже если и так, все равно другого выхода нет, кроме как этот патч

Если тебе он не помог , то тогда нужно в настройках каждого клиента поставить вот такие параметры :
Вот после них действительно производительность снизится, но зато будеш уверен в целостности данных. (у нас раньше с этим были большие проблемы, особенно когда выснялась порча данных в конце отчетного периода перед отчетом, это хуже чем кошмар )
Auto Reconnect Level =1
Cache write =off
check sum =1
close behaid ticks =0
delay writes =off
end of job =off
file cache level =0
file write through = off
large internet packets =off
lock delay =1
lock retries =5
max cache size =1
name cache level =0
opportunistic locking = off
packet burst =off
true commit=off
use extended file handles =on

на серваке:
set NCP File Commit=off

компрессию на томе с данными отключить
Аватара пользователя
Юрий aka qwerty
 
Сообщения: 152
Зарегистрирован: 12 июн 2002, 06:32
Откуда: г.Иркутск


Вернуться в Novell

Кто сейчас на конференции

Сейчас этот форум просматривают: нет зарегистрированных пользователей и гости: 2

cron